Sculptural MCM Ebonized Mahogany Bench
Best statement piece for mid-century modern design enthusiasts.
This is an original 1950s mid-century modern tufted bench, meticulously restored by Stamford Modern. It is crafted from solid new ebonized mahogany, showcasing impeccable vintage craftsmanship. The design is accented with elegant nickel sabots and features a sumptuous blue velvet tufted cushion, offering both style and comfort. This timeless piece serves as a striking statement furniture item suitable for various interior settings, blending classic mid-century aesthetics with contemporary appeal.

Know before you buy
This piece has been meticulously restored by Stamford Modern to ensure it is in excellent condition. While it retains its original 1950s integrity, the restoration process ensures it is structurally sound and aesthetically refreshed for modern use.
The tufted cushion is designed as an integral part of the bench's aesthetic and comfort profile. It is intended to remain in place to maintain the piece's intended sculptural silhouette.
To maintain the luster of the ebonized mahogany, dust regularly with a soft, dry microfiber cloth. Avoid using harsh chemical cleaners or wax polishes, as these can dull the finish or damage the wood over time.
At 18 inches high, this bench is at a standard dining height, making it a functional and stylish alternative to traditional dining chairs. Ensure your table has enough clearance underneath to accommodate the 62-inch width.
The nickel sabots are the metal caps found at the base of the bench's legs. While they serve as a sophisticated design detail that highlights the mid-century aesthetic, they also provide a protective finish for the wood feet.
Velvet is a resilient fabric, but it is best suited for areas where it won't be subjected to heavy, daily wear. We recommend keeping it out of direct sunlight to prevent the blue hue from fading over time.
